Key differences between Soon and Sling

  • Pricing: Sling starts at $2 /User/Month. Soon pricing is not publicly listed.
  • Free trial: Soon offers a free trial; Sling does not.
  • User satisfaction: Sling scores higher with a 4.5-star average.
  • Deployment: Soon supports SaaS/Web/Cloud; Sling supports SaaS/Web/Cloud, Mobile - Android, Mobile - iOS.

Sling

Best for medium-sized businesses needing simple, efficient employee scheduling and communication.

Choose if
  • You manage shift-based teams in retail, hospitality, or healthcare sectors.
  • You want an intuitive interface for easy schedule creation and real-time updates.
  • You need integrated time tracking with seamless shift swapping and time-off requests.
Consider alternatives if
  • Your organization requires extensive app integrations and highly customizable workflows.
  • You need advanced notification customization beyond basic options.
